I have the TDK 24x burner. It is a great burner, although it doesn't work with XP's native burning (no big deal, it comes with Nero). Anyways, The 24x burner with the blue tray is a Lite-On (checked the fcc # on mine and it definitely is). Someone told me that there is a 24x with the normal white tray, and it is a Sanyo. I havn't seen any of those. Great price. I will likely pick up another one.
